Hello, All
I am trying to write a docbook xml document and convert it to html.
here is my xml document:
<?xml version="1.0"?>
<?xml-stylesheet href="d:/docbook/html/docbook.xsl" type="text/xsl"?>
<!DOCTYPE book SYSTEM "d:/docbook1/docbookx.dtd">
<book>
<title>book title</title>
<chapter><title>Introduction</title>
<para>para1</para>
<para>para2</para>
<para>para3</para>
<para>para4</para>
</chapter>
<chapter><title>Getting Started</title>
<para>para1</para>
<para>para2</para>
<para>para3</para>
<para>para4</para>
</chapter>
</book>
If I use IE5 with msxml3 installed, it works fine.
but when I use command line as following:
D:\docbook>java com.jclark.xsl.sax.Driver text.xml
d:/docbook/html/docbook.xsl > test.html
I got error message as below:
file:/d:/docbook/html/index.xsl:273: no such function: key
here is line 273 in the file:
<xsl:template name="generate-index">
<xsl:variable name="terms" select="//indexterm[count(.|key('letter',
substring(&primary;, 1, 1))[1]) = 1]"/>
Could any one tell me what's wrong?
